Lohbado dreamed of skeletons dancing in the back room of an old hotel. The "touriste" arrow signs are from an old hotel on Saint-Catherine in Montreal, photo taken about five years ago. It was near the Hotel Bolero. The grave was taken several years ago at a graveyard in Gaspe. Dance macabre is an old tradition of acknowledging death. Things wear out. The body becomes a corpse. One of the most famous sets of images about death is Hans Holbein's dance of death from about 1526.
